SnapIT® was born out of a desire to change lives and bridge the tech skills gap. After a day spent mentoring disadvantaged middle school students, founder Neelima Parasker realized the lack of exposure these students had to engineering and technology careers. When asked if they knew any engineers as mentors, the students responded with a resounding “Nobody.” This experience inspired Parasker to create SnapIT® with the initial goal of positively impacting 10 lives each year. Since then, the innovative SPRNT® model has far surpassed that goal, training and developing hundreds of students annually.

THE MODEL
The SPRNT® model is a regenerative approach to IT talent development, consisting of the following key components:
SnapIT Trainings™
SPRNT® begins with customized, short-duration Hi-Tech IT Trainings, typically lasting less than a semester. SnapIT® partners with workforce agencies and organizations that provide funding to support students’ training expenses.
SnapIT Solves™
Upon completing initial trainings, entry-level interns and apprentices gain hands-on experience working on real-world projects with less intense timeline requirements, further enhancing their skills and practical knowledge.
SnapIT Pods™
Graduates of the SPRNT® program are placed in SnapIT Pods™, teams of 4-6 members that include experienced senior developers and junior developers. These pods work on client projects, delivering high-quality solutions while providing a supportive environment for continued learning and growth.
The SPRNT® model is designed to be self-sustaining, with each cohort of graduates contributing to the training and mentorship of the next generation of IT talent. This regenerative approach ensures a continuous pipeline of skilled, diverse professionals ready to meet the demands of the ever-evolving tech landscape.
